WebGiven, x+y =12 and xy = 14x+y =12Squaring both sides, we get,(x+y)2 =122=>x2 +y2 +2xy = 144=>x2 +y2 +2(14) =144=>x2 +y2 =144−28=>x2 +y2 =116. WebSOLUTION 15 : Since the equation x 2 - xy + y 2 = 3 represents an ellipse, the largest and smallest values of y will occur at the highest and lowest points of the ellipse. This is where tangent lines to the graph are horizontal, i.e., where the first derivative y '=0 .
